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Rowguid
|
|||
|---|---|---|---|
|
#18+
Добрый всем день! (у кого нет - пусть будет) В различных литературах есть упоминание, что значение поля rowguid "...уникально в пределах планеты..."(или что то в этом духе). Ситуация: с центрального сервера разгоняю записи по удаленным серверам (с сформированным значением rowguid), филтруя их по коду района. Вопрос: может ли при вставке записи на нескольких уд. серверах случиться запись с одинаковым значением rowguid.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.02.2002, 11:49 |
|
||
|
Rowguid
|
|||
|---|---|---|---|
|
#18+
rowguid - это атрибут, показывающий что эту колонку можно использовать при настройке репликации как содержащую уникальные значения. Если таблица, имеющая поле uniqueidentifier в качестве primary key, участвует в merge репликации, то без указания данной опции SQL Server создаст ЕЩЕ ОДНУ колонку с типом uniqueidentifier, пометит ее как rowguid и будет использовать как содержащую уникальные значения. Правильно я понимаю, что в вашем случае primary key - целочисленное поле, а rowguid существует только ради репликации? >может ли при вставке записи на нескольких уд. серверах случиться запись с одинаковым значением rowguid rowguid генерится в момент создания записи и потом не меняется. Microsoft гарантирует уникальность созданных guid'ов.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 28.02.2002, 12:30 |
|
||
|
Rowguid
|
|||
|---|---|---|---|
|
#18+
Добрый день! Извиняюсь за несвоевременный ответ, но вчера раб. день закончился. Спасибо за ответ GreenSunrise. В репликации (merge) я немного понимаю т.к. одну базу делал с этим видом репликации. В данном случае (др. база) необходимо слить данные с уд. серверов в одну базу и затем с помощью пакета DTS производить обмен данными (на долговременной основе), для этого и хочу применить rowguid(и некоторые доп. поля). Т.к. база начинала создаваться до меня, то сейчас приходится выкручиваться. Репликация вещь неплохая но структура базы у нас постоянно меняется, а т.к. сервера 7.0, то хотя бы хранимых процедур для изменения таблиц находящихся под репликацией там как известно нет, поэтому хочу попробовать DTS. Еще раз сп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.03.2002, 07:47 |
|
||
|
|

start [/forum/topic.php?fid=46&msg=32024056&tid=1823722]: |
0ms |
get settings: |
10ms |
get forum list: |
19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
62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
56ms |
get tp. blocked users: |
2ms |
| others: | 220ms |
| total: | 389ms |

| 0 / 0 |
